Goffs Breeze-Up Topper Mrair Sheds Maiden Status at Lingfield

Victorious Forever's George Scott trainee Mrair (Mehmas), the £880,000 Goffs UK Breeze-Up topper who ran second to a quirky sort at Newmarket just over two weeks ago, confirmed the promise of that debut effort with a dominant performance in Monday's British Stallion Studs EBF Novice Stakes at Lingfield. "I wasn't disappointed, the owner wasn't disappointed [with the debut effort] and we always wanted to get two runs into him before, potentially, going to [Royal] Ascot," explained Scott. "Ryan [Moore] educated him well and he did what he had to do....

Wootton Bassett's Cameo Routs Lingfield Oaks Trial Rivals

Coolmore and Westerberg's G3 Park Express Stakes fifth Cameo (Wootton Bassett) benefitted greatly from a jump up in trip and entered G1 Oaks calculations with a powerful display, and a fourth success for Aidan O'Brien, in Saturday's Listed William Hill Oaks Trial at Lingfield. "Today was the first time I've ridden her," said Ryan Moore. "She's a scopey filly, she handled the track well and did everything right. She picked up from a long way out and kept going. She is a filly that will get better as the year...

Frankel's Giselle Registers Facile Success in the Lingfield Oaks Trial

With just two overmatched rivals in opposition, Aidan O'Brien trainee Giselle's superior form and class told as the daughter of Frankel overcame Lingfield's Epsom-style intricacies, delivering a facile nine-length success in the track's William Hill-sponsored Listed Oaks Trial on Saturday. Last term's G3 Staffordstown Stud Stakes third and 3-10 pick was a shade keen racing third in a first-time hood through the initial stages of this seasonal debut. Negotiating the downhill section and taking closer order in the home straight, she seized control approaching the quarter-mile marker and bounded clear...

Bobby Flay's Oaks Entry Go Go Boots Goes Two-For-Two at Lingfield

Bobby Flay's Go Go Boots (GB) (Night Of Thunder {Ire}), a June 6 G1 Betfred Oaks entry, justified long odds-on favouritism for John and Thady Gosden with a three-length triumph in Monday's Download The Raceday Ready App Fillies' Novice Stakes over 10 furlongs at Lingfield. Last year's €230,000 Arqana Breeze-Up graduate had previously won at the track having annexed her debut over one mile in December.   Go Go Boots remains unbeaten with a straightforward success at @LingfieldPark! This Epsom Oaks-entrant looks a filly to follow for John and Thady...

Military Order Seals Lingfield Trials Double For Godolphin

With match fitness an advantage leading into Saturday's Listed Fitzdares Lingfield Derby Trial S., it was Godolphin nominee and G1 Betfred Derby entry Military Order (Ire) (Frankel {GB}--Anna Salai, by Dubawi {Ire}) who stepped forward for a career high in the 12-furlong test. He set the seal on a Lingfield Trials double for the Godolphin-Appleby-Buick triumvirate with a 1 1/4-length success from impressive Newmarket winner Waipiro (Ire) (Australia {GB}), with The King's Listed Newmarket S. runner-up Circle Of Fire (GB) (Almanzor {Fr}) trailing home 4 1/4 lengths adrift in third....

Godolphin's Eternal Hope Subdues Lingfield Oaks Trial Rivals

Godolphin's Eternal Hope (Ire) (Teofilo {Ire}--Voice Of Truth {Ire}, by Dubawi {Ire}) does not possess a ticket for next month's G1 Oaks, but qualifies to be one of the first in line for the supplementary stage after a stylish victory in Saturday's Listed Fitzdares Oaks Trial at Lingfield. She had yet to make a start on the turf and continued that trend after the day's stakes contests were switched to the track's synthetic surface. Cheveley Park Stud's Sacred Powers To Chartwell Triumph

Cheveley Park Stud's Sacred (GB) (Exceed And Excel {Aus}--Sacre Caroline, by Blame) had failed in three prior attempts at Group 1 level, but top-table options remain open after she collected a third pattern-race triumph in Saturday's recalibrated G3 Fitzdares Chartwell Fillies' S. at Lingfield. She was making her first start on a synthetic surface here and 2021's G3 Nell Gwyn S. and G2 Hungerford S. victrix returned to action for this seven-furlong heat coming back off a second over the same trip in October's G2 Challenge S. at Newmarket. Sea the Stars' Third Realm Takes the Derby Trial

There were shades of High-Rise (Ire) (High Estate {Ire}) at Lingfield on Saturday as Sheikh Mohammed Obaid Al Maktoum's silks were carried to success by Third Realm (GB) (Sea the Stars {Ire}) in the Listed Lingfield Derby Trial. Winning the second blue riband prep within the week for his owner-breeder and the Roger Varian stable, the 14-1 shot who broke his maiden over an extended 10 furlongs at Nottingham Apr. 17 was held up early by David Egan before making his move downhill to the home straight. Oaks Trial Success For Lemon Drop Kid's Sherbet Lemon

Fourth behind TDN Rising Star Noon Star (Galileo {Ire}) in a 10-furlong Wetherby novice Apr. 25, Apple Tree Stud's Sherbet Lemon (Lemon Drop Kid) was on top at the end of a close call for Saturday's Listed Lingfield Oaks Trial. Shadowing the leader Loving Dream (GB) (Gleneagles {Ire}) throughout the early stages, the 28-1 shot worked her way to the front with over a furlong remaining and dug in to prevail by 3/4 of a length from Save a Forest (Ire) (Kingman {GB}) with less than two lengths covering the...

Freshman Sire Bobby's Kitten Off the Mark at Lingfield

Kirsten Rausing homebred Sands of Time (GB) (Bobby's Kitten) became the first winner for her Lanwades Stud-based freshman sire (by Kitten's Joy) with an impressive five-length score for Mark Johnston at Lingfield. 1st-Lingfield, £6,400, Mdn, 6-7, 2yo, f, 5f 6y (AWT), :59.31, st/sl. SANDS OF TIME (GB) (f, 2, Bobby's Kitten--Starlit Sands {GB} {GSW-Fr, GSP-Eng & Ger, $128,929}, by Oasis Dream {GB}) was sharpest from the stalls and seized immediate control of this debut. Holding sway throughout, the 10-3 chance was shaken up off the home turn and powered clear...

Camelot's English King Too Good In the Derby Trial

Twelve months after Anthony Van Dyck (Ire) (Galileo {Ire}) brought kudos back to Lingfield's Listed Derby Trial, the former group 3 contest played host to another with potential to roll it back to the glory days of High-Rise (Ire), Kahyasi (Ire) and Slip Anchor (GB). While Bjorn Nielsen's colours were being adorned by Frankie Dettori at Newmarket, the Ed Walker-trained English King (GB) (Camelot {GB}) was carrying them around this Epsom-like terrain as if he was on wheels. Sea the Stars's Miss Yoda Takes the Oaks Trial

Following two fluent wins over a mile at Kempton and Sandown in August and September with a runner-up finish in the G3 Zetland S. at Newmarket in October, Miss Yoda (Ger) (Sea the Stars {Ire}) looked the clear pick of the trio heading for Friday's Listed Lingfield Oaks Trial which the John Gosden stable won in 2019 with the subsequent Epsom heroine Anapurna (GB) (Frankel {GB}).
